“…There are two main reasons for this choice: (1) the open structure of CNF/SMF filters presents a low pressure drop through the reactor together with even gas-flow distribution; (2) the mesoporous morphology of the graphitic CNF ensures low mass-transfer resistance, and the high thermoconductivity of CNF/SMF Inconel allows strict temperature control during the exothermic acetylene hydrogenation. 13,19,20 Another major issue in the acetylene hydrogenation is the selectivity to ethylene, since this reaction is performed industrially to remove acetylene impurities from ethylene feedstock. 21 The control of the oligomerization of acetylene, which causes the deactivation of the catalyst by covering the metal surface with polyolefin (green-oil) [22][23][24][25][26] is also important.…”
